Vehicle History
Brand Heritage
Brand Heritage: Arctic Cat has a long-standing history in snowmobile manufacturing, known for innovation in performance and design. The 2012 models represent a significant evolution with the introduction of the ProClimb and ProCross chassis.
Model Evolution
Model Evolution 2012: The 2012 model year marked a substantial shift with the introduction of the highly acclaimed ProClimb (mountain) and ProCross (trail) chassis platforms, which offered significant improvements in rider positioning, handling, and weight distribution over previous designs. The 1100 Turbo engine provided a competitive power advantage.
Engine Progression: The 1100cc engine, particularly in turbocharged form, was a significant upgrade, offering competitive power figures against other manufacturers' offerings. The 800cc 2-stroke continued to be a popular option for riders prioritizing lightweight and agility.
Production
Manufacturing Location: Arctic Cat snowmobiles are primarily manufactured in Thief River Falls, Minnesota, USA.
